In the above electron configuration, the highest energy level (3) is marked with green color. The 3 rd energy level contains 3s and 3p subshells. There are 2 electrons in the 3s subshell and 1 electron in the 3p subshell. So aluminum has a total of 2 + 1 = 3 valence electrons.

Chlorine (Cl) can also form a bond with aluminium (Al). Aluminium has three extra electrons that can easily be used by chlorine atoms to bond. The formula of the compound is AlCl 3.
